Speaker of the Rivers State House of Assembly, Rt. Hon. Martin Amaewhule, has won the All Progressives Congress (APC) primary election and has been declared the party’s flag-bearer for the Obio/Akpor Federal Constituency.

Amaewhule is the current Speaker of the 10th Rivers State House of Assembly.

He has been a member of the Rivers State House of Assembly since 2011, representing Obio-Akpor Constituency I.

He presides over the Assembly that attempted to impeach the governor of the state, Sim Fubara, on different occasions.

He is a diehard loyalist of the Minister of the Federal Capital Territory, Nyesom Wike, and is widely regarded as an ally of the former governor.
